Why We cant Sleep
Many people struggle with falling asleep or staying asleep. Stress… processed food… artificial light… and overstimulation keep the nervous system wired long after the day is done. Even when we lie down, the body may not feel safe enough to let go. Lack of sleep shows up quickly in the form of fatigue, sugar cravings, brain fog, and irritability. Over time it leads to deeper imbalances such as high blood pressure, blood sugar swings, anxiety, autoimmune flares, and even heart strain.
How Sleep Heals the Body
When we enter deep sleep, the body works like a sacred repair shop. Cells regenerate… tissues mend… the brain clears toxins… and the heart finds its rhythm again. Sleep regulates hormones that control appetite and stress. It restores the immune system so it can protect us from illness. It lowers inflammation and supports healthy blood sugar. Without it, the body cannot fully heal, no matter how well we eat or what herbs we take. Sleep is nature’s nightly detox and renewal.

Herbal and Nutritional Allies for Sleep
Magnesium supports muscle relaxation and calms the nervous system… it is often called the relaxation mineral.
Mineral-rich teas like oatstraw, nettle, and passionflower soothe tension and ease the mind.
Adaptogens such as ashwagandha and tulsi balance stress hormones so the body is not wired at night.
Ancestral foods like bone/meat broth, organ meats, and mineral-rich hydration restore balance to the nervous system and help promote steady sleep cycles.
These gentle allies do not force the body into sleep… they guide it back into balance so rest comes naturally.
